The Mother who was restored कथा
Renuka, wife of the sage Jamadagni and mother of Parashurama, is honoured across the Deccan as a form of the Devi. Mahur is enshrined among the eighteen Maha Peethas as her seat, where she is worshipped as Ekaveerika.
As with many Peethas, texts differ on which part of Sati is linked here; Mahur's glory rests on Renuka as one of the eighteen supreme seats and the Mother of Parashurama.

The Datta connection
Mahurgad is one of the principal Dattatreya kshetras; pilgrims often take darshan of Renuka, Datta and Anasuya together.

Yatra guide यात्रा
✈️ By Air
Nanded airport is the nearest regional option; Nagpur is a larger airport further away.
🚉 By Train
Nanded and Kinwat are the nearer railheads; most reach Mahur by road.
🚗 By Road
Mahur lies in the Kinwat hills of Nanded district; a ghat road climbs Mahurgad.
